Kuwait Telecommunications Company K.S.C.P. (KWSE:STC)
Kuwait flag Kuwait · Delayed Price · Currency is KWD · Price in KWF
0.6820
+0.0230 (3.49%)
At close: Feb 1, 2026

KWSE:STC Ratios and Metrics

Millions KWD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Jan '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
681689537562584427
Market Cap Growth
26.77%28.25%-4.44%-3.76%36.84%0.35%
Enterprise Value
626627474508543355
Last Close Price
0.680.690.500.500.490.35
PE Ratio
19.9820.2117.1217.2117.599.52
Forward PE
17.059.759.759.759.759.75
PS Ratio
1.992.011.601.721.741.44
PB Ratio
2.842.882.232.312.421.80
P/TBV Ratio
3.673.722.882.943.132.17
P/FCF Ratio
14.0314.197.937.779.5910.36
P/OCF Ratio
7.427.515.636.097.356.23
PEG Ratio
-1.141.141.141.141.14
EV/Sales Ratio
1.831.831.411.551.611.20
EV/EBITDA Ratio
6.337.316.715.767.685.22
EV/EBIT Ratio
13.2913.3014.0710.289.609.30
EV/FCF Ratio
12.9012.917.007.028.918.63
Debt / Equity Ratio
0.150.150.160.150.140.06
Debt / EBITDA Ratio
0.360.360.460.370.430.19
Debt / FCF Ratio
0.730.730.550.500.560.36
Asset Turnover
0.730.730.740.750.820.77
Inventory Turnover
16.7516.7516.3319.0823.1018.26
Quick Ratio
0.990.991.141.241.221.06
Current Ratio
1.141.141.291.381.341.20
Return on Equity (ROE)
14.21%14.21%12.96%13.47%13.88%19.54%
Return on Assets (ROA)
6.26%6.26%4.63%7.09%8.64%6.22%
Return on Invested Capital (ROIC)
23.58%23.39%19.00%26.05%29.17%21.32%
Return on Capital Employed (ROCE)
16.90%16.90%12.00%17.40%20.00%14.90%
Earnings Yield
5.01%4.95%5.84%5.81%5.68%10.51%
FCF Yield
7.13%7.05%12.61%12.88%10.43%9.65%
Dividend Yield
5.77%5.51%6.94%7.06%6.13%8.64%
Payout Ratio
101.26%101.26%110.65%87.70%83.02%60.55%
Total Shareholder Return
5.77%5.51%6.94%7.06%6.13%8.64%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.